Legal careers can be boosted by blogs

June 7, 2005

The Associated Press reports that having an online presence is an important part of managing your career. Career counselors are recommending that people build online presences through among, other things, blogs.

Blogs are also being touted as a strategy for career enhancement. The idea is for professionals to start blogs that focus on topics of interest to people in their fields. The goal is to position yourself as an expert in the field — at least among people who read blogs.

A blog is actually better for the career than a Web portfolio, which is just another form of the resume, said Jeff Kaye, CEO, of recruiting firm Kaye/Bassman in Dallas.

A good blog can show that you are up to date on the latest ideas and news in your industry, he said. A resume or Web portfolio only highlights your past accomplishments.

The story makes clear prospective employers do online searches for applicant’s names. A credible online presence depicting one’s writings and prior work means a lot. At the same time, the absence of an online presence can imply an applicant has not been up to much professionally.
